Background
The vehicle-mounted automobile data recorder is used as main equipment for automobile driving picture recording and automobile driving parameter recording of the automobile, and is widely applied to the fields of domestic and foreign commercial automobiles and taxis. The main stream of vehicle-mounted driving cameras in the market is mostly single-pair external cameras, and the vehicle-mounted driving cameras are used for recording the images outside the vehicle driving. With the deep demand of customers and the development of technology, the demands of customers on the inner and outer double-shot cameras are larger and larger, and compared with the outer single-lens camera, the inner and outer double-shot cameras can record the driving state of a driver in a cockpit through the inner lens, including fatigue monitoring, calling, smoking behavior detection and the like, or monitoring the riding behavior of a driver in a vehicle, and can be used as an accident handling basis, a dispute basis and the like. With the wide application of the inside and outside double-camera in domestic and overseas markets, privacy concerns are brought to customers. The rest behavior or other non-driving behavior of the user in the non-working and non-driving state can be recorded due to the real-time recording or alarming function of the inner lens, and infringement or other unnecessary influence is generated on the privacy of the user, therefore, the user can use the lens cover to cover the camera lens when the camera lens is not required to be shot, so that the privacy protection effect is achieved.
The existing lens cover is a plastic baffle, and the plastic baffle is adhered to the position of a camera lens by matching with back glue, so that the functions of shielding an inner lens and protecting privacy are achieved. The lens cover is mounted by the adhesive tape, is inconvenient to mount, is influenced by the service life of the adhesive tape, cannot be frequently mounted and taken down in performance, and is short in service life.

Referring to fig. 1, fig. 2 and fig. 4 together, a description will be given of a protective cover according to an embodiment of the present utility model. The protection cover 100 comprises a shell 10 and a magnetic attraction piece 20, wherein the shell 10 is provided with a containing cavity 101, the containing cavity 101 is used for containing the camera 52 and the mounting part 51, and one end of the containing cavity 101 is provided with an opening 102; the edge of the opening 102 of the housing 10 is used for being matched with the clamping installation part 51, and when the housing 10 is covered on the installation part 51, the opening 102 clamps the installation part 51 to prevent the housing 10 from moving along the transverse direction (perpendicular to the depth direction Z of the accommodating cavity 101); the housing 10 is provided with a shielding part 11 at one side of the accommodating cavity 101, and the shielding part 11 is used for being in clearance fit with the camera 52 and shielding the camera 52. The magnetic attraction piece 20 is used for matching with the magnetic attraction mounting part 51, when the shell 10 is covered and buckled outside the mounting part 51 and the camera 52, the magnetic attraction piece 20 and the mounting part 51 are magnetically attracted, so that the shell 10 is prevented from moving along the longitudinal direction (the depth direction of the accommodating cavity 101), the shell 10 and the mounting part 51 are kept stable, and the magnetic attraction piece 20 is arranged at the bottom of the accommodating cavity 101. When the shell 10 covers the camera 52 and the mounting part 51, the magnetic attraction piece 20 can be in magnetic attraction fit with the mounting part 51 to fix the shell 10 on the mounting part 51, and at the moment, the shielding part 11 is just positioned at the front end of the camera 52, so that the shielding part 11 can shield the camera 52, the camera 52 is prevented from automatically photographing, and the privacy safety of a user is protected. Because the shell 10 covers and buckles outside the installation department 51 and the camera 52, there is the clearance between shielding department 11 and the camera 52, avoid when installing safety cover 100, the front end of the camera 52 is scraped to shielding department 11, causes the camera's 52 camera lens damage. By adopting the magnetic attraction piece 20, the assembly and the disassembly of the protective cover 100 are facilitated, the attraction force can be ensured in the repeated assembly and disassembly processes, the stability of the protective cover 100 and the mounting part 51 is ensured, and the service life of the protective cover 100 is prolonged.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 2 to 4, the protection cover 100 further includes a cushion pad 30, and the cushion pad 30 is used to protect the camera 52 during the insertion of the camera 52 into the accommodating cavity 101; the cushion pad 30 is a flexible member, the cushion pad 30 is attached to the inner side of the shielding portion 11, and the cushion pad 30 extends from a position of the accommodating chamber 101 adjacent to the opening 102 toward the bottom of the accommodating chamber 101. The lens of the camera 52 protrudes from the mounting portion 51, and in the process of mounting the protective cover 100, because the angle of the mounting portion 51 entering and exiting the protective cover 100 is different, when the part of the shielding portion 11 is close to the lens of the camera 52, the cushion pad 30 can prevent the shielding portion 11 from being in hard contact with the lens, and plays a role in protecting the lens.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3-5, the cushion pad 30 is a fleece layer or foam layer. By adopting the velvet layer or the foam surface layer, the wear to the lens can be reduced when the lens is contacted or rubbed, and the lens has a better protection effect.
In an emb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3 to 5, the shielding portion 11 is formed by protruding one side of the housing 10 outwards, the housing 10 is recessed inside the shielding portion 11 to form a groove 110, the groove 110 is used for avoiding the camera 52, and the groove 110 is disposed along the depth direction Z of the accommodating cavity 101. On the one hand, the clearance between the rest of the housing 10 and the mounting portion 51 can be reduced, the stability between the housing 10 and the mounting portion 51 can be improved, and on the other hand, the distance between the shielding portion 11 and the camera 52 can be increased, so that the shielding portion 11 is prevented from rubbing against the lens of the camera 52. Specifically, the cushion 30 is adhered to the bottom of the recess 110, so that the position of the cushion 30 can be conveniently positioned to match the position of the camera 52.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3 to 5, a holding strip 13 is provided in the housing 10, and the holding strip 13 is disposed along a depth direction Z of the accommodating cavity 101; the height of the end of clip strip 13 near opening 102 gradually decreases toward the direction near opening 102. By employing the clip strip 13, the structural strength of the housing 10 can be enhanced, and the mounting portion 51 can be clamped, improving the stability between the housing 10 and the mounting portion 51. The height of the clip strip 13 refers to the dimension of the clip strip 13 in the thickness direction of the housing 10.
Alternatively, the clip strip 13 is located at one or both ends of the longitudinal direction X of the accommodating chamber 101, so that the movement of the housing 10 in the longitudinal direction X of the accommodating chamber 101 can be restricted.
Alternatively, the number of the clip strips 13 is plural, and the plurality of clip strips 13 may be juxtaposed. By employing a plurality of clip strips 13 in parallel, stability between the housing 10 and the mounting portion 51 can be further improved.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3 to 5, a support plate 40 is detachably mounted at the bottom of the receiving chamber 101, and the magnet 20 is connected to the support plate 40. By adopting the support plate 40, the installation of the magnetic attraction member 20 can be facilitated so that the position and direction of the magnetic attraction member 20 are matched with the magnetic attraction position of the installation portion 51. Of course, in another embodiment of the present utility model, the supporting plate 40 may be fixed to the bottom of the accommodating cavity 101 by a buckle or an adhesive, or the magnetic attraction member 20 is fixed to the bottom of the accommodating cavity 101 by an adhesive, so as to fix the magnetic attraction member 20.
Optionally, a connecting post 12 is provided in the housing 10, and the support plate 40 is connected to the connecting post 12 by a screw. Threaded holes matched with the screws are formed in the connecting columns 12. In this way, the support plate 40 can be locked with the connection post 12 by means of screws, so that the detachable connection of the support plate 40 is achieved.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3 to 5, the magnetic attraction member 20 is located on a side of the support plate 40 away from the opening 102, and the magnetic attraction plate 21 is attached to a side of the support plate 40 near the opening 102, where the magnetic attraction plate 21 is adapted to guide a magnetic field of the magnetic attraction member 20 to match a magnetic attraction position on the mounting portion 51. That is, by providing the magnetic attraction plate 21 in a shape conforming to the magnetic attraction position, the magnetic force can be uniformly distributed at the magnetic attraction position. Therefore, the magnetic attraction area can be increased, and the magnetic attraction stability is improved; and the magnetic field intensity can be enhanced, and the magnetic field weakening caused by the gap between the magnetic attraction piece 20 and the magnetic attraction position is avoided.
Alternatively, the magnetic induction plate 21 is an iron plate or a silicon steel plate. Thus, the magnetic attraction plate 21 and the magnetic attraction piece 20 can mutually attract each other to change the magnetic field distribution and strengthen the strength of the magnetic field at the side of the support plate 40 close to the opening 102.
Optionally, the support plate 40 is provided with a slot, and the magnetic attraction member 20 is disposed in the slot. Thus, the mounting position of the magnetic attraction piece 20 is convenient to position, and the stability of the position of the magnetic attraction piece 20 is ensured.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3 to 5, the supporting plate 40 is a plastic plate. This can prevent the support plate 40 from affecting the magnetic field of the magnetic attraction member 20 and prevent the plastic plate from interfering with the magnetic attraction of the magnetic attraction member 20 and the mounting portion 51.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 3 to 5, the magnetic attraction member 20 is a magnet. Alternatively, the magnetic attraction member 20 is a neodymium magnet. In this way, a magnetic force can be provided so that the mounting portion 51 magnetically attracts.
Referring to fig. 1 to 3, an automobile data recorder according to an embodiment of the utility model includes a main body 50, a mounting portion 51 and a camera 52, the mounting portion 51 is disposed on one side of the main body 50, the camera 52 is mounted on the mounting portion 51, the camera 52 is electrically connected with the main body 50, the automobile data recorder further includes a protection cover 100 in any of the above embodiments, the housing 10 is covered and fastened outside the mounting portion 51 and the camera 52, and the magnetic attraction piece 20 is magnetically attracted and matched with the mounting portion 51. By adopting the protective cover 100 in the above embodiment, the protective cover 100 can be fastened to the camera 52 and the mounting portion 51 when the user does not need to take a photograph, so as to shield the camera 52 from taking a photograph, and protect the privacy of the user. Moreover, through the cooperation of magnetic attraction, easy to assemble and dismantlement are difficult for becoming invalid.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 1 to 3, a magnetic plate (not shown) is mounted on a side of the mounting portion 51 away from the main body 50, and the magnetic member 20 magnetically engages with the magnetic plate. Thus, the mounting portion 51 can be made of non-magnetic material, which is convenient for processing the mounting portion 51 and can be matched with the magnetic induction plate 21 conveniently to enhance the attraction force.
Alternatively, the magnetic plate may be a magnet, an iron plate, a silicon steel plate, or the like, and may be adhered to the surface of the mounting portion 51, so that the magnetic force can be enhanced without changing the structure of the mounting portion 51.
Alternatively, a magnet is mounted in the mounting portion 51 at a position corresponding to the magnetic attraction plate, so that the magnetic force can be enhanced.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 1 to 3, the width (i.e., the dimension along the X-axis direction in fig. 1) of the end of the mounting portion 51 near the bottom of the accommodating chamber 101 is tapered toward the bottom of the accommodating chamber 101. This facilitates the fastening of the protective cover 100 to the mounting portion 51. Specifically, one end of the mounting portion 51 near the accommodation chamber 101 may be provided with chamfers at both ends of the mounting portion 51 in the width direction, the chamfers being capable of gradually reducing the width of the mounting portion 51 so as to be inserted into the housing 10.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 1 to 3, the width of the opening 102 (i.e., the dimension along the Y-axis direction in fig. 3) gradually increases toward a direction away from the bottom of the accommodating chamber 101. This can facilitate the fastening of the protective cover 100 to the mounting portion 51. Specifically, the edges of the housing 10 adjacent the opening 102 are provided with chamfers that enable the width of the opening 102 to be gradually increased so as to facilitate the covering of the housing 10 on the mounting portion 51.
In one embodiment of the present utility model, referring to fig. 1 to 3, a step structure 501 is formed at a position where the mounting portion 51 is connected to the main body 50, and the step structure 501 is used to cooperatively locate an end of the housing 10 near the main body 50. In this way, when the magnetic attraction member 20 magnetically attracts the attachment portion 51, the movement of the protection cover 100 in the depth direction Z of the accommodation chamber 101 can be restricted, and the stability of the protection cover 100 can be improved.
